Joan Webbe 1508–1577 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1508

Birth Location: Lewes, Sussex, East Sussex, England, United Kingdom

Death Date: 2 August 1577

Death Location: Lewes, Sussex, East Sussex, England, United Kingdom

Father: William Webbe

Mother: Elizabeth Kembold

Spouse(s): John Randolph

Children(s): Agnes Randolph, Barnard Randolph, Robert Randolph, Edward Randolph, Joan Randolph, Mary Randolph, Sarah Randolph, Tho Randolph

The story of Joan Webbe began in 1508 in Lewes, Sussex, East Sussex, England, United Kingdom. Joan Webbe married John Randolph, and had children including Agnes Randolph, Barnard Randolph, Edward Randolph, Joan Randolph, Mary Randolph, Robert Randolph, Sarah Randolph, Tho Randolph. Joan Webbe passed away in 1577 in Lewes, Sussex, East Sussex, England, United Kingdom.
